About Port Alice

Port Alice is a small village located on the northern portion of Vancouver Island, British Columbia, nestled along the shores of Neroutsos Inlet, an arm of Quatsino Sound. It sits within the broader North Island region, approximately 470 kilometres northwest of Vancouver and roughly 65 kilometres southwest of Port Hardy, which serves as the nearest regional hub. The surrounding landscape is defined by dramatic coastal mountains, dense temperate rainforest, and the deep, sheltered waters of the inlet. The area is rich in freshwater resources, with rivers and lakes throughout the region. Port Alice experiences a mild, wet maritime climate, with warm summers and relatively moderate winters tempered by the Pacific Ocean, though annual rainfall is substantial given the lush coastal setting. Port Alice is a small, remote community with a population of just several hundred residents, embodying a quiet, tight-knit village character. Life here revolves around the natural environment, with outdoor recreation playing a central role in daily living. The surrounding wilderness offers opportunities for fishing, kayaking, hiking, and wildlife viewing, drawing those who appreciate a rugged and peaceful coastal lifestyle. The community has historical roots tied to industrial development and maintains a sense of resilience and pride common to many remote Vancouver Island communities. Its location along the inlet gives it a scenic, somewhat isolated character that appeals to those seeking a slower pace of life far removed from urban centres. The economy of Port Alice has historically been anchored in the forest industry, with pulp and paper production playing a significant role in the community's development over the decades. While the industrial sector has faced changes over time, forestry and related activities continue to influence the local employment base. Fishing and aquaculture also contribute to the regional economy, reflecting the community's deep connection to its coastal and marine environment. Given its remote location, Port Alice has a modest amenity base that covers essential everyday needs, including basic retail, local services, and community facilities. Residents often travel to larger centres on the North Island for a broader range of services, healthcare, and shopping. The village's small scale and natural surroundings attract those who value self-sufficiency and community connection over urban convenience. ☀️ Weather & Climate in Port Alice

Environment Canada Climate Normals · 1981–2010 OLDER PERIOD
Nearest official weather station to Port Alice: PORT HARDY A
Note: 1991–2020 Climate Normals are not yet published for PORT HARDY A. The 30-year normals shown are from the older 1981–2010 reference period. 1991–2020 is the current WMO 30-year reference period; these older normals are shown for reference only.
Source: Environment and Climate Change Canada — Canadian Climate Normals 1981–2010 ↗
MetricJanFebMarAprMayJunJulAugSepOctNovDec
Mean daily temp (°C)4.24.45.57.310.112.314.314.412.28.85.53.7
Mean daily max (°C)6.57.38.911.213.915.917.818.115.811.88.16.0
Mean daily min (°C)1.81.42.03.46.18.710.710.78.55.73.01.3
Total precip (mm)24716016012579815473110257312251
Total rainfall (mm)23515215512379815473110257308240
Total snowfall (cm)12.48.84.91.50.10.00.00.00.00.13.910.8
